Practical Tips for Smooth Sailing on Yolo 247
Even when a platform is user-friendly, some pointers can enhance the experience and avoid common pitfalls. Here are a few tips for those new to Yolo 247:
- Double-check your mobile number or account details before confirming a recharge to avoid errors.
- Keep track of your transaction history; it can be handy for reconciling payments or troubleshooting issues.
- Use stable internet connections to prevent interrupted processes, especially during payment authorization.
- Take advantage of any available notifications or alerts to stay informed about upcoming due dates for bills.
- Remember that patience helps—sometimes payment gateways experience delays, but these usually clear up quickly.
